  • Do you have a burning question about the AMCAS Work & Activities section? You came to the right place!
    In this video, I’ll be addressing 16 of the questions med school applicants most frequently ask us about the AMCAS Work & Activities section - questions like:
    “Which details should I include?”
    “How do I list my hobbies?”
    “How do I choose my most meaningful experiences?”
    “Can you combine activities?”
    By the end of the video, you’ll have everything you need to make sure the Work & Activities section of your application emphasizes all of the skills, experiences, and accomplishments that make you an excellent candidate for medical school.
